Troubleshooting Common Viron Chlorinator Cell Issues

Dealing with a malfunctioning Viron chlorinator device can be annoying , but several common issues are quite fixable. First , inspect the electrical supply – make certain it’s adequately connected and the breaker hasn't tripped. A dirty cell is a common culprit; carefully flush the cell plates with a chlorine-safe descaling solution – don't using harsh chemicals. Low salt levels in the pool can even affect cell performance ; test the levels and modify as needed . If the LED is blinking an fault code, examine the Viron documentation for precise troubleshooting advice. Finally, if none steps repair the problem, it’s best to call a qualified professional for more assistance.
